Product Specific Information
PEP-101 is a 18 amino acid synthetic peptide whose sequence corresponds to amino acid residues 1-18 of rat VAMP-2. The sequence of this peptide is (amino to carboxy terminus): M (1)-S-A-T-A-A-T-V-P-P-A-A-P-A-G-E-G-G (18)
This peptide may be used for neutralization and control experiments with the polyclonal antibody that reacts with this product and rat VAMP-2, catalog # PA1-766. Using a solution of peptide of equal volume and concentration to the corresponding antibody will yield a large molar excess of peptide (~70-fold) for competitive inhibition of antibody-protein binding reactions.
Reconstitute with 0.1 mL of distilled water.
Target Information
The vesicle associated membrane proteins (VAMP) or synaptobrevins are calcium binding proteins specific to eukaryotes. VAMPs, along with synaptosomal associated protein of 25 kDa (SNAP-25) and syntaxin, form the core complex of soluble NSF attachment protein receptor (SNARE) proteins that interact with the soluble proteins N-ethylmaleimide-sensitive factor (NSF) and alpha-SNAP. These membrane associated proteins play a key role in the regulation of vesicle membrane fusion with the plasma membrane. The Clostridium tetani neurotoxin is a metalloprotease with specificity for VAMP. In Alzheimer`s disease, VAMP levels of all isoforms appear to be significantly lowered. It is suggested that VAMP-2 is a resident protein of the insulin-sensitive glucose transporter type 4 (GLUT4) compartment and that it is required for GLUT4 vesicle incorporation into the cell surface in response to insulin.
